New York, NY

Fresh off the success of Tekashi 6ix9ine’s Hot 100 hit “FEFE” featuring Nicki Minaj, the controversial rapper is feeling the heat from the New York District Attorney.

The D.A. is recommending he serve a stint of one to three years in state prison and register as a sex offender for violating his plea agreement, The Blast reports. A letter from Manhattan’s D.A. Office outlines the reasoning behind their decision.

“Defendant has had over two years to demonstrate to this Court that the role he played in the sexual exploitation of a thirteen-year-old child was an aberration in his otherwise law-abiding life,” the letter reads. “He has failed to do so.”

The rainbow color-haired artist previously pled guilty to the use of a child in a sexual performance in 2015. In exchange for his guilty plea, sentencing was to be deferred for two years. This made him eligible for Youthful Offender adjudication, which would seal his criminal record. All he needed to do was stay out of trouble.

6ix9ine, whose real name is Daniel Hernandez, has struggled to satisfy the court’s demands though. He’s facing assault charges in Houston for allegedly choking 16-year-old fan in January. In May, he was arrested for driving on a suspended license and accused of assaulting a police officer, which he denies. Charges in the latter case have since reduced to a misdemeanor.

Sentencing for 6ix9ine is scheduled to take place on October 2.
